An emblematic figure of the early 20th century, Paul Klee participated in the expansive Avant-Garde movements in Germany and Switzerland. From the vibrant Blaue Reiter movement to Surrealism at the end of the 1930s and throughout his teaching years at the Bauhaus, he attempted to capture the organic and harmonic nature of painting by alluding to other artistic mediums such as poetry, literature…
Sargent was born in Florence, in 1856, the son of cultivated parents. When Sargent entered the school of Carolus-Duran he attained much more than the average pupils. His father was a retired Massachusetts gentleman, having practised medicine in Philadelphia. Sargent's home life was penetrated with refinement, and outside it were the beautiful influences of Florence, combining the charms of sky …
Paul Klee nació en 1879 en Münchenbuchsee, Suiza, y creció en una familia de músicos. En vez de seguir la tradición musical de la familia, decidió estudiar arte en la academia de Munich. Sin embargo, el amor que durante su niñez sintió por la música siempre fue parte importante en su vida y su obra.
